黑狐家游戏

命令行连接FTP服务器的指南,命令访问ftp服务器

欧气 1 0

在当今数字化时代,FTP(File Transfer Protocol)作为一种文件传输协议,仍然广泛应用于各种场景中,如网站维护、软件开发和远程数据备份等,通过命令行工具连接FTP服务器,不仅能够提高工作效率,还能更好地掌握网络操作技能,本文将详细介绍如何使用命令行工具连接FTP服务器,并提供一些实用技巧和建议。

准备工作

在使用命令行工具之前,确保你已经安装了必要的软件包,对于大多数Linux发行版,可以通过以下命令安装FTP客户端:

命令行连接FTP服务器的指南,命令访问ftp服务器

图片来源于网络,如有侵权联系删除

sudo apt-get install ftp

或者使用其他包管理器进行安装。

基本命令介绍

  1. 登录到FTP服务器: 要连接到FTP服务器,可以使用ftp命令,格式如下:

    ftp <server>

    其中<server>是你想要连接的FTP服务器的地址。

    ftp ftp.example.com
  2. 输入用户名和密码: 连接后,系统会要求你输入用户名和密码,默认情况下,你需要提供这两个信息才能访问FTP服务器上的资源。

  3. 切换目录: 在FTP会话中,你可以使用cd命令来浏览不同的目录,要进入某个特定目录,可以输入:

    cd /path/to/directory
  4. 列出目录内容: 使用lsdir命令可以列出当前目录下的文件和文件夹,其中ls通常用于简短列表,而dir则显示更详细的文件信息。

  5. 下载文件: 要从FTP服务器下载文件,可以使用get命令,要从当前目录下下载名为filename.txt的文件,可以输入:

    get filename.txt
  6. 上传文件: 如果需要将本地文件上传到FTP服务器上,可以使用put命令,要将本地文件localfile.txt上传到服务器上的同一目录下,可以输入:

    put localfile.txt
  7. 退出FTP会话: 完成所有操作后,可以通过quit命令退出FTP会话:

    quit

高级功能与技巧

  1. 匿名登录: 对于某些公开的FTP服务器,可能不需要特定的用户名和密码即可访问,在这种情况下,可以使用anonymous作为用户名,电子邮件地址作为密码来进行匿名登录。

    命令行连接FTP服务器的指南,命令访问ftp服务器

    图片来源于网络,如有侵权联系删除

  2. 被动模式(Passive Mode): 有时由于防火墙或路由器的限制,主动模式(Active Mode)可能会导致连接失败,此时可以选择被动模式,通过设置set passive命令来实现。

  3. 保存和恢复会话: 通过使用saveload命令,可以在断开连接后再重新建立相同的FTP会话,从而节省时间。

  4. 批量处理文件: 利用脚本或自动化工具,可以实现批量的文件传输和管理任务,大大提高工作效率。

  5. 安全考虑: 当涉及到敏感数据的传输时,应确保FTP服务器支持加密连接,比如SFTP(SSH File Transfer Protocol),以保护数据的安全性。

常见问题及解决方法

  1. 无法连接到FTP服务器

    • 检查网络连接是否正常。
    • 确认服务器地址拼写正确且可访问。
    • 尝试更改端口(通常是21)或其他相关配置参数。
  2. 权限不足

    • 验证是否有足够的权限访问所需的文件或目录。
    • 联系FTP管理员获取更多权限。
  3. 文件损坏或丢失

    • 确保在传输过程中没有中断。
    • 使用校验和验证文件的完整性。
  4. 速度慢或不稳定

    • 调整缓冲区大小或尝试不同的FTP客户端。
    • 检查服务器负载和网络带宽情况。

通过上述步骤和方法,我们可以有效地利用命令行工具连接FTP服务器并进行各种文件操作,这不仅有助于提升工作效率,还能够为未来的网络管理和开发工作打下坚实的基础,在实际应用中,不断探索和学习新的技术和方法也是非常重要的,希望这篇文章能为你提供一个良好的起点,帮助你更好地掌握和使用FTP命令行工具。

标签: #命令行连接ftp服务器

黑狐家游戏
  • 评论列表

留言评论